  5. I don’t like it either but given the investment in these guys (in Price’s case, $30M per year), I sort of get it. We all remember the Ryans and Gibsons and Seavers who pitched 300 innings a year for years on end What we don’t remember are the guys who blew their arms out after a year or 2 and were done. One of the greatest and classiest quotes I ever heard was by Bruce Suter, the great Cubs reliever many years ago. When his arm finally went, people kept telling him how sorry they were. Suter said something like “Don’t feel sorry for me. I had 15 great years. Feel sorry for the kid down in A ball who just blew his arm out and will never get the chance to experience what I have.”

  21. They had an interesting tidbit on the radio broadcast. Target Field is located almost exactly halfway between the Equator and the North Pole. It’s 1 1/4 miles south of the 45th parallel. You’d think it would be much further north.
